Transaction 8a350dff18956864ab1b4c07b7b9daddc12ea33f52478d1c4aa73d9739118661
1 Input
1 Output
-
8a350dff18956864ab1b4c07b7b9daddc12ea33f52478d1c4aa73d9739118661:0
- value
- 666118
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f0f4aeb79a1de850b2d92b423f43d99ae5cc61a
- address
- bc1qtu8546me580g2zedj26z8apanxh9e3s6ha0ejx